Factors That Can Make or Break Your Marketing Strategy


Crafting a successful business often relies on your marketing strategy. A solid plan not only opens doors to new opportunities but also deepens your understanding of customers, extends your influence, and helps you wisely invest in future marketing efforts.

But here's the catch: just having a strategy isn't a guaranteed ticket to success. Let's delve into five crucial factors that could be the game-changer for your marketing initiatives.

Understanding Your Audience
The essence of a successful marketing strategy is knowing your audience inside out. Dive into defining the demographics and crafting a vivid buyer persona to truly connect with your customers. It's about getting into their world, understanding their needs.

Data Tracking
When it comes to marketing strategy, monitoring data is indispensable. Tools like Google Analytics provide essential insights into page traffic, user behavior, and visit sources, aiding in optimizing marketing investments.

Focus on Customers
Prioritizing customer satisfaction is pivotal in successful marketing strategies. Thriving companies often prioritize enhancing customers' lives over solely focusing on profits, aligning their strategies to add significant value to their customers' experiences.

Embrace Passion
Passion is a catalyst for success. Being passionate about your business and marketing strategy is crucial. Lack of enthusiasm can reflect poorly in your products, marketing efforts, and customer interactions. Rekindle this passion by revamping products, refining customer engagement, or seeking new approaches.
